Q2 Planning — Brackwood Tools Pricing

Branch managers: list prices on the Brackwood hand-tool line rise 4% next quarter. No discounting below 10% without regional sign-off. Clearance rules unchanged. Update shelf tags by the changeover date head office circulates. Do not preview new prices to trade customers. The reasoning sits in the confidential note below.

board note of bajop-yaweg: The western region missed its Pelys quota by 58.0 percent last quarter. Pelysek Foods plans to raise the Belius list price by 44.0 percent in July. The steering committee signed off on a budget of $133.8 million for Project Pelax. The renewal with Zoraelix Systems closes at $61.9 million a year, 12.7 percent above the last contract.

- [ ] **Step 7: Breaker override escrow.** After sealing the signing keys for the Tallgrove upstream API circuit breaker, confirm the support team can force the breaker open during a full outage. The override bundle lives in the sealed escrow drawer and is useless without its unlock phrase. Two ceremony witnesses must initial this step before proceeding. The escrow bundle is decrypted with the recovery passphrase that follows.

vault phrase of kahip-kahop = holath-quenmir

Subject: On-call handover — orders soft deletes

Hi Marek,

Quick note before you take over. We shipped the soft-delete change to the Cartwheel orders table last night: rows now get a deleted_at timestamp instead of being removed. Plugin authors querying orders directly must filter on deleted_at IS NULL, or they'll see ghost orders. The compat view orders_active handles this automatically. Docs are updated in the Cartwheel developer portal. If plugin authors hit anything weird, route them to the integrations inbox.

escalation mailbox, tafop-fahif: oliael@tolvaqlabs.corp

Hi Dorit — handing over catalog cache invalidation before I rotate off. For plugin authors: Shelfwright invalidates by product key, not by category, so if your plugin mutates category metadata you must emit an explicit `catalog.touch` event or stale listings will persist up to six hours. Never call the purge endpoint in a loop; it is rate-limited per tenant and silently drops excess calls. Batch your keys instead. The event payload schema and batching limits are documented on the internal page.

operations page: https://jenkins.zemvarcloud.local/job/merge_requests/repo/build/73930b4b30f0a8ed